BETFAIR SPORTS
With more than one million registered
customers, Betfair is the world's No. 1 online
betting exchange, a concept that the company
pioneered and one that has revolutionised the
wagering industry. A betting exchange is an online
marketplace where punters bet at odds set by
other punters, rather than a bookmaker, bringing
together people with directly opposing views. The
result? Punters get much better odds, whether
you want to back a selection, lay a selection, or
bet in-play, because you are betting against other
punters, not a bookmaker or the tote.
BETFAIR AUSTRALIA
Betfair Australia is the only licensed betting
exchange in Australia. A joint venture between
Betfair in the UK and Publishing and Broadcasting
Limited, it is licensed in Tasmania, with its main
operation based in Hobart.

HOW BETFAIR WORKS
A good way to understand Betfair is to
think of it in similar terms to the Stock
Exchange. Just as you buy a share on the
Stock Exchange if you think it's cheap,
you back a selection to win with Betfair
if you believe the odds are generous. And
just as you sell a share when you think
it's too expensive, with Betfair you lay a
selection (offer odds to other punters)
when you feel the odds aren't generous
enough. Betfair takes a commission of
between 2%-5% on your net winnings on
each market. Punters who have a net loss
on a market don't pay any commission.
Crucially, Betfair's system guarantees that
the winner gets paid as soon as a market
is settled. There is no risk of default, with
punters unable to bet on credit. When
the outcome is known, the winning party
receives the dividend, less commission.
